Randyc Posted January 14, 2008 Report Posted January 14, 2008 I made this Harmonica Case for myself. The outside of the case is made from 8-9 oz. vegatable tan cowhide. The interior is made from 5-6 oz. vegatable tan cowhide. I used a combination of Fieblings medium brown dye and Fieblings antique stain. Randy Quote
